The Legal Fallout

Diddy’s legal troubles escalated significantly when the FBI raided his homes, uncovering not just evidence of his alleged criminal activities but also a stockpile of text messages revealing the patterns of his abuse. Prosecutors have reportedly interviewed over 50 witnesses and obtained over 120 electronic devices related to the case. The sheer volume of evidence points to a disturbing and systematic approach to exploitation that transcends individual incidents.

The charges Diddy faces are severe: racketeering, sex trafficking, and kidnapping. These allegations stem from decades of reported abuse, with claims of physical violence dating back to the 1990s. Victims have come forward detailing not just drugging and coercion but also physical assaults and threats that kept them silent.
